Handover: Sproutline Scheduler

Handing off the plant-watering scheduler ahead of the Quillmere release. The cron evaluation loop is stable; the only open item is the moisture-sensor debounce tweak, which Daria reviewed and approved last sprint. No schema changes this cycle, so no migration step is needed. Rollback is a plain redeploy of the previous build. The service starts with the configuration values listed below:

deployment values, yafop-tahof:
HOLIX_HOST=holix.zemvarsys.internal
HOLIX_PORT=3306

## Cold Bucket Archiving — Onboarding

Frostvault moves buckets untouched for 180 days into archive tier. The `frostvault-archiver` job runs nightly from the ops box. Config lives in `/etc/frostvault/archiver.env`. Retention and tier thresholds are set there; don't edit mid-run. The archiver authenticates to the storage API with a token defined on the next line of that file.

vault entry, kajog-kawig: VAULT_KEY13=6b0c5c5ead68a

**Onboarding: Relaybrook broker upgrade**

Plugin authors: Relaybrook 5 drops the legacy ack protocol. Rebuild against SDK 5.0+ before the cutover window. Plugins using manual offsets must migrate them via the `rb-migrate` tool; it runs once per plugin and is idempotent. The tool reads and rewrites offsets in the shared metadata database using the connection string below.

replica DSN, kajep-yahag: mssql://praok_svc:iF@db-8d68.plorvaio.local:5432/eliion

### Changed defaults

Resolver timeouts in Quillhost's fetcher were causing intermittent lookup failures under load, traced to a too-aggressive negative-cache TTL and a single upstream resolver. Defaults now retry across two resolvers, extend the lookup timeout, and shorten negative caching so transient failures recover faster. Existing deployments that pinned the old values are unaffected; everyone else picks these up on next restart. Reviewers should verify overrides against the new defaults shown below.

settings of tagef-bawif:
DRUIX_HOST=druix.zemvarlabs.internal
DRUIX_PORT=8000